This depends. If the molecules are of different kinds (ie: Water and Glass), then it is called adhesion. If they are of the same kind, it is called cohesion.The tendency of molecules of the same kind to stick to one another is known as cohesion. This is what keeps the molecules together a good example being in water.

It depends on the amount of clay that is in the granular soil. Typically granular soils have low cohesion. A clean sand will have 0 cohesion.
